Creating

Top  Previous  Next

 

AdvancedJTable has exactly the same constructors as JTable. You can therefore construct an instance the same way you do with JTable.

 

Example:

 

//construct an AdvancedJTable with 5 rows and 3 columns

AdvancedJTable table = new AdvancedJTable(5, 3);

 

//construct an AdvancedJTable with a DefaultTableModel as its datamodel.

DefaultTableModel dtm = new DefaultTableModel();

AdvancedJTable table = new AdvancedJTable(dtm);

 

//construct an AdvancedJTable with a couple of rows.

Object[][] rowData = new String[][] {

{"Mary", "Lloyds"},

{"John", "Berry"}

};

Object[] columns = new String[]{"Name", "Surname"};

DefaultTableModel model = new DefaultTableModel(rowData, columns);

AdvancedJTable table = new AdvancedJTable(model);